Specified by design engineers worldwide, this nylon stock sheet boasts a substantial 0.555-inch thickness, a generous 31-inch length, and a 15-inch width, providing ample material for diverse fabrication needs. Manufactured from high-performance nylon, it exhibits excellent tensile strength, abrasion resistance, and a low coefficient of friction. This material is machinable to tight tolerances and offers good chemical resistance, making it suitable for use in demanding environments, including mechanical components, wear pads, and structural elements in various industrial machinery.

|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using standard cutting tools not designed for dense plastics. | Employ carbide-tipped blades or specialized plastic cutting tools for clean, chip-free edges. |
| Applying excessive heat during machining, leading to melting. | Utilize appropriate cooling methods such as air or coolant during cutting and machining operations. |
